Henry of Ghent on Real Relations and the Trinity: The Case for Numerical Sameness without Identity

I argue that there is a hitherto unrecognized connection between Henry of Ghent’s general theory of real relations and his Trinitarian theology, namely the notion of numerical sameness without identity.
